Innovations in Film: 65mm Black and White Film in Oppenheimer

Overview

FotoKem gives in-depth tour of the new scientific and artistic workflows that had to be invented in order to realize Christopher Nolan's unique vision of using both color and black & white 65mm film in the same motion picture
